We had a law against blasphemy of any sort. It was hardly ever used, so we got rid of it.
Due to the law you could face jail time for burning the quran, the bible, the torah or do anything deliberately offensive towards any accepted religion (yes, different religions here in Denmark needs to be accepted as being a religion by the danish government in order to have rights as a religion and stuff... It's probably for the better, since it doesn't give things like scientology any rights at all).
Edit: because Scientology is not accepted as a religion here
